Nathaniel (Daniel) BURNHAM was born 4 April 1682 in Ipswich, Massachusetts Bay Colony
Nathaniel (Daniel) BURNHAM was the child of Thomas BURNHAM and Lydia PENGRY (PINGREE) and the grandchild of: (paternal) Thomas BURNHAM and Marie LAWRENCE (maternal) Moses PENGRY and Lydia Abigail CLEMENTSSpou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):
Nathaniel (Daniel) married Mary STIMPSON 4 August 1720 in Ipswich, Province of Massachusetts Bay . Mary STIMPSON was born 4 March 1696 in Ipswich, Massachusetts, USA.
Nathaniel (Daniel) BURNHAM died 16 April 1746 in Boxford, Province of Massachusetts Bay.

The name 'Massachusetts' originates with native Americans in the Massachusetts Bay area (from the language of the Algonquian nation). The name translates roughly as 'at or about the great hill.' (statesymbolsusa.org)
1620 - 1627 - Plymouth Colony, New England
1628 - 1686 - Massachusetts Bay Colony
1686 - 1689 - Dominion of New England
1689 - 1692 - Massachusetts Bay Colony
1692 - 1775 - Province of Massachusetts Bay
1776 - 1788 - Crown Colony of Massachusetts Bay
February 6, 1788 - Massachusetts becomes 6th U.S. state
